Do you mean for drawing chances? The Slav, Queen's Gambit Declined and Queen's Gambit Accepted all have draw statistics in the region of ~55% for masters at chess365, the Indians are more attacking lines (although can be quite safe). 

They don't reach the 64.8% draws of the Petroff (not without a bit of help from White) though.
